Students in Cherokee County can still get school lunches even while the school system is out for Thanksgiving Break.

The school system is offering a special to-go free meal service for all students during the break.

Meal pick up will be from 4 to 5 p.m. Friday, Nov. 20, at two locations only — Hasty Elementary School Fine Arts Academy in Canton and Carmel Elementary School in Woodstock — pickup locations can be chosen by parents on the form they fill out. Students do not have to live in each school’s attendance area to pick up there.

All meals will be provided at no cost to all Cherokee County School District students and to any child from 0 to 18 years old. Both sites will distribute seven days’ worth of breakfasts and lunches. This meal service is funded by USDA grants.

To order your meals for pick up Friday, Nov. 20, you can complete the form by clicking on the link below. The Meal Order Form must be submitted by 8 a.m. Tuesday, Nov. 17.

There will be no regular meal pick-up on Monday, Nov. 23. That service will resume on Monday, Nov. 30.
